Hey, welcome aboard! Quick ticket for you: the Pinecone transcoding farm keeps dropping 4K jobs when the queue depth passes 200. Looks like the worker pool hits a memory ceiling and silently restarts. Darla thinks it's the chunk cache not evicting. Start with the staging cluster, and reference the build below.

build token for kagaf-hahof: htk14_9d3d4d26d7d8de

Subject: Cut-over complete — Lumora SDK parity

The cut-over from the legacy Kotlin SDK to the new Rust-core SDK finished last night. Parity checks pass on all endpoints except batch retries, which now use the shared policy. Please review the diff against the matrix before we archive the old repo. The active client configuration follows.

config for bagep-kageg:
ULADOR_LOG_LEVEL=warn
ULADOR_METRICS_HOST=metrics.ulador.tolvaqcorp.corp
ULADOR_POOL_SIZE=32

Hi Renna,

Welcome to the on-call rotation! Before your first shift, please skim the postmortem for the stale-cache bug that hit Quillbox last month — the security angle matters because stale entries briefly served another tenant's data. Action items are mostly done, but review the open ones. The full writeup lives on the internal page below.

operations page: https://jenkins.zemvarcloud.local/job/merge_requests/repo/build/73930b4b30f0a8ed

The watchdog on the TapPoint kiosk app restarted the UI process four times last night, all within the 02:00–03:00 maintenance window, which is expected behavior. However, I noticed the watchdog's restart log is written with world-readable permissions — flagging this for the security review since it includes process arguments. I've attached the sanitized log excerpt and the watchdog config diff from last week's deploy. If the reviewer needs the unredacted capture, they should request it at the address below.

escalation mailbox, yafog-kafof: eliok@xolmarcloud.local